Find dy/dx: x^(2)y-2y+5=0 Find dy/dx: x^(2)y-2y+5=0 @Mathematics

OpenStudy (turingtest):

\[{d \over dx}(x^2y-2y+5)=0\]\[2xy+x^2y'-2y'=2xy+y'(x^2-2)=0\]\[y'={2xy \over 2-x^2}\]
